Réglage de la taille de la fenêtre d'une application sur OS X?
Je suis en utilisant Xcode 7 sur Yosemite. J'ai créé une nouvelle application OS X, et il est venu avec un plan de montage. Lorsque je lance l'application, la fenêtre d'application est minuscule.
Quelle est la façon la plus simple de définir la taille de fenêtre par défaut lorsque l'application est lancée?
Idéalement, je suis à la recherche d'un storyboard solution, pas un programatic solution. Toutefois, si l'un n'existe pas, alors un programatic solution suffit. Je ne souhaitez pas définir le nombre minimal/maximal de taille de la fenêtre; l'utilisateur doit être en mesure de la taille comme ils l'entendent.
Vous devez vous connecter pour publier un commentaire.
J'ai tout compris...
Vous avez besoin de changer le point de Vue initial du Contrôleur de la Vue (
NSView
) la taille de ce que vous voulez dans la Taille de l'Inspecteur. Vous n'avez pas besoin de toucher à la Fenêtre Contrôleur ni la Fenêtre.Important: Ne pas oublier de supprimer Xcode est dérivé de données; sinon, il se souviendra de la valeur précédente qui était utilisée la première fois que l'application a été exécuté.
À la vue de chargement, donc dans la méthode viewDidLoad vous pouvez soit placer un appel à une fonction ou à une ligne de code qui ressemble à ceci :
auto.vue.fenêtre?.setFrame(NSRect(x:0,y:0,largeur: 1440,hauteur: 790), affichage: true)
Ceci permettra de définir votre point de vue initial de la NSRect vous spécifiez et de l'afficher.